| Abstract/Notes | AbstractAn unusual form of sector zoning has been recorded in some Lewisian zircons. The sectors lie in a plane cut perpendicular to the c-axis and are observed as variations in the intensity of cathodoluminescence, and in trace-element concentrations. Sectors radiating from the centre of growth out to the {100} faces exhibit low-intensity cathodoluminescence and are enriched in Y and depleted in Hf and Zr. Those radiating to the {110} faces are brightly luminescent, slightly enriched in Hf and depleted in Y. X-ray diffraction data, and comparison with previous studies of zircons, suggest that the sectors vary slightly in crystallographic orientation, such that the boundaries between sectors form discontinuities in the structure. |
